搭建你的第一台Ubuntu服务器可以是一个既令人兴奋又有挑战的过程。对于许多技术爱好者和企业用户来说,Ubuntu服务器因其开源特性、强大的社区支持和高效的性能而成为热门选择。本文将通过最新的性能评测、市场趋势,以及一些实用的DIY组装技巧,为你全面解析如何成功安装与配置Your第一台Ubuntu服务器。

近年来,随着云计算和虚拟化技术的迅猛发展,市场对服务器的需求加速增长。Ubuntu服务器凭借其高可定制性和稳定性,在企业环境中受到广泛青睐。特别是在搭建Web服务器、文件服务器或数据库服务器时,Ubuntu的优势愈发明显。2023年的性能评测显示,最新版本的Ubuntu Server在资源管理和响应时间方面比以往更有优势,特别是对多核CPU和大内存的优化使其更适合重负载场景。
安装Ubuntu服务器并不仅是下载、刻盘,然后傻傻地跟随安装向导。选择合适的硬件是第一步。越来越多的用户倾向于DIY组装服务器,这样可以根据实际需求自由选择CPU、内存和存储。组装时,需要关注主板的兼容性、CPU的冷却方案以及充分的电源供应,确保服务器在运行期间保持稳定。配置SSD作为系统盘,将有效提高操作系统的加载速度和整体响应。
性能优化是让你的Ubuntu服务器表现更佳的关键。务必配置好系统的网络参数,确保数据传输速率达到最佳状态。可以考虑使用LAMP(Linux、Apache、MySQL、PHP)栈构建Web服务,并通过工具如NGINX或Varnish进行缓存加速,以此提升网站或应用的访问速度。引入监控工具,如Prometheus与Grafana,能够实时追踪服务器状态,从而预防潜在的性能瓶颈。
除开硬件和软件,不容忽视的还有安全性问题。定期更新系统和应用程序至关重要,可以有效地防止安全漏洞带来的威胁。使用防火墙和入侵检测系统,能够进一步保护服务器不被攻击。定制合适的用户权限和访问控制策略,也能在一定程度上防止不必要的风险。
对于一些初学者而言,搭建和管理Ubuntu服务器的复杂过程可能令人生畏。但通过本教程中介绍的步骤与技巧,搭建自己的服务器并不再是一项遥不可及的任务。
常见问题解答(FAQ)
1. 如何选择适合的硬件配置?
选择硬件配置时应考虑处理器、内存和存储,根据计划运行的应用类型来决定。
2. Ubuntu服务器的安装步骤有哪些?
安装步骤主要包括下载ISO镜像、制作启动盘、设置BIOS启动顺序、安装过程中的分区和选择软件包等。
3. 在安装Ubuntu服务器后,有必要进行哪些安全设置?
必须设置防火墙(如UFW)、确保SSH服务安全配置,并定期更新系统和应用。
4. 如何进行性能监控?
使用工具如htop、Nagios或Zabbix等,可以帮助监控CPU、内存和网络使用情况,预防潜在问题。
5. 有没有推荐的资源用于学习Ubuntu服务器管理?
可以参考Ubuntu官方文档、书籍如《The Linux Command Line》和社群论坛的经验分享。